这款插件将github的菜单栏、标题、按钮等公共组件进行汉化,除此之外它还对项目描述进行人机翻译,让新手可以更快速的了解操作github。 可以看下下面图片是汉化后的效果,相比浏览器的自带的机器翻译功能,准确非常多安装教程该插件基于油猴脚本管理器(Tampermonkey)开发,所以需要先安装油猴插件,支持Chrome, Microsoft 步骤二:打开 插件安装地址: GitHub 中文化插件 – GreasyFork 托管【发布版】(仅大版本更新)步骤三:安装后,当你再打开github的网址,就会在油候脚本管理器中看到 GitHub 中文化插件 一起用,github的网页也会变成中文
现在,通过github-chinese这款开源(GPL-3.0 license)、免费的汉化插件,只需简单2步即可实现 GitHub 网页端中文化界面! 大家可以在我的公众号《追逐时光者》回复关键字:《github加速、github加速神器、GitHub加速》,获取3个GitHub免费加速神器。 tab=readme-ov-file#github 插件功能 中文化 GitHub 菜单栏,标题,按钮等公共组件。 支持对 “项目描述” 进行人机翻译。 Tampermonkey插件安装 Tampermonkey(油猴)是一款广受欢迎且功能极其强大的浏览器脚本管理扩展。它的核心价值在于允许用户发现、安装和管理“用户脚本”(Userscripts)。 下载地址:https://www.tampermonkey.net/index.php 未安装汉化插件之前界面效果 Chrome 浏览器安装汉化插件 安装脚本:https://www.tampermonkey.net
准备工作 Jenkins 要从 GitHub 上面拉取代码需要安装相关插件,插件可以在 Jenkins 的插件管理中搜索下载。 安装 GitHub 插件 首先,需要连接 GitHub 有一个基本的插件要安装,可以在插件管理中搜索 GitHub,然后找到 GitHub 这个插件进行安装即可。 安装 Git Parameter 安装了 GitHub 插件就已经实现了连接 GitHub,虽然这个基本的插件本身也有选择分支的参数,但是分支参数没有限制,无法做到根据实际的分支和 Tag 名称去选择, 所以最好另外安装一个可以支持选择分支和 Tag 的插件,这个支持分支的插件的名字是 Git Parameter,这个插件可以实现在拉取 GitHub 的代码的时候选择分支和 Tag 并通过参数的形式传入到拉取过程中 涉及插件: GitHub: https://plugins.jenkins.io/github Git Parameter: https://plugins.jenkins.io/git-parameter
言归正传,大家肯定平时都在用Github,毕竟这是一个开源的时代,脱离了开源社区,一切都是闭门造车。 那既然开源,肯定会经常浏览GitHub中的项目(Gitee我用的少,不予置评),Github的内容量还是很丰富的,涵盖了所有的知识面,但是也有一些弊端,毕竟我们不可能每个项目都下载或者Clone下来,经常会在 Web端先简单浏览一下,比如在查看文件或者具体问题内容的时候,不是很方便,每次都需要进入到很多层级,才能点击具体的文件查看内容,今天给大家安利一个Chrome插件,可以通过目录的形式,快速查看文件结构, 02 多文件查看 banner切换 加入书签 在之前,如果我们需要查看多个文件,或者多个文件之间需要做对比的时候,就需要打开多个窗口,多个窗口之前进行切换,很不方便,来看看这个插件如何使用的。 03 快速搜索 精准定位 Shift+S事件 在之前,如果你想在任意一个项目中,寻找一个文件,需要用官方的Go to file功能,还不是很好用,来看看Octotree插件的功能: 可以点击工具栏的放大镜图标
我们先做一个简单的工具栏的控件,了解一下eclipse的插件开发流程! 1 新建一个插件工程 ? 2 创建自己的插件名字,这个名字最好特殊一点,一遍融合到eclipse的时候,不会发生冲突。 1 导入了插件所需要用到的jar包 2 导入了插件依赖的库 3 源文件 4 插件按钮图片 5 插件的配置信息 MANIFEST.MF 插件的捆绑信息 Manifest-Version: 1.0 Bundle-ManifestVersion: 2 Bundle-Name: 我的插件 Bundle-SymbolicName: com.test.myplugin; singleton:=true 提供的插件类Activator.java 1 package com.test.myplugin; 2 3 import org.eclipse.jface.resource.ImageDescriptor 最后让我们运行一下这个插件吧! ? 启动方式1 直接在overview界面点击; 启动方式2 也可以点击运行或者DEBUG按钮,运行方式选择Eclipse Application。
博客评论插件 Gitalk 集成 为了给博客加个第三方评论插件,首先选择了 github 开源项目 Gitment,然后种种原因原作者不再更新服务器api跨域转发失败;所以 Gitment 暂时不能用 然后选择了 Gitalk:作者 Github 项目地址,演示Demo; 另外 Gitalk 的使用方式和 Gitment 神似,下面是配置流程 link rel="stylesheet" href="https Application Client ID', //这里的 ID 对应 GitHub Application 创建的 ID clientSecret: 'GitHub Application Client Secret', //同上 repo: 'GitHub repo', //Github 的仓库名称(可新建) owner: 'GitHub repo owner', //Github 仓库的所有者(github账户名) admin: ['GitHub repo owner and collaborators, only these guys can initialize
因为上述原因,所以我们现在急需的是一个proto插件,可以帮助我们把一个proto文件直接转化成kotlin的。当然我们第一目标是最好能在kotlin官方找到这样一个能力,直接支持。 其次就是github找一个仓库能转化proto到kt的工程。最最不行只能自己动手了啊。 ) val newSample = ProtoBuf.Default.decodeFromByteArray<Sample>(encode) 只要引入kotlinx-serialization插件之后 只能去从github搜索下有没有别的更好支持的库。 pbandk pbandk 仓库地址 这个库通过protobuf-java编写了一个proto插件。 由于上述的种种原因,我们还是打算自己写一套protoc插件。
已经有几个插件可以对网络数据进行节点排名,比如NetworkAnalyzer和CentiScaPe,他们可以计算有向或无向网络的拓扑参数。 这些插件比其他常用的插件提供了更多的中心性测定指标,但是一些其他重要的特性和最近发展的方法他们并未包括进去。不同的方法聚焦不同的拓扑特点或者,相似的特征有着不同的计分策略。 为了让生物工作者对网络特点的利用更加辩解,我们编写了cytoHubba插件以执行我们最新发展的算法和几个流行的算法。
那刚好我在逛 GitHub 的时候,发现了我关注的一个大佬 star 了一个叮咚的抢菜助手。 我点进去看了一下,虽然上线就两三天时间,已经有近 500 的 star 了,增长速度非常快。 能上得去 GitHub 的小伙伴,可以通过下面的地址下载 app 哈,仅支持安卓手机。 https://github.com/Skykai521/DingDongHelper/blob/main/app/release/app-release.apk 如果访问不是很顺畅的话,可以点击下方的卡片跳转到我的公众号 打开叮咚助手的方式参考下面这张图: 成功开启插件之后,再打开叮咚买菜 APP 的购物车页面,程序会自动跳转到结算页面,并自动选择时间,点击下单等操作。你只需要在成功下单之后立即支付即可。 当然了,插件无法保证 100%下单成功,同时,作者也提到了: 希望二哥推荐的这款插件能真正地帮助到有需要的人。 最后,愿疫情早日结束!
牵手GitHub.jpg 目录 1.GitHub 和 Git 的前世今缘 2.Git 的下载安装 2.1Git 下载 2.2Git 安装 3.Git 的初始配置 3.1查看安装的 Git 的版本 使用 Git 可以在本地操作 GitHub 上的项目,增删改,操作完了,在推送到 GitHub 上保存。 2 Git 的下载安装 ---- 以 windows 环境下安装为例,Linux 和 Mac 系统请自行查找 Git 安装资料 2.1 Git 下载 Git的官方下载地址 ? 下载Git2.png 如果你的下载速度较慢,也可以选择去软件应用中心下载,这里也推荐一个百度软件下载中心,但里面的软件不一定是最新的,还是建议在官网上下载的。 说明一点,远程仓库也不止 GitHub 一家,国内也有 码云,CSDN,但这些在名气上都比不上 GitHub,毕竟 GitHub 是全球性的,这些代码托管平台和 GitHub 在使用上其实相差不大,学会
一、Jenkins中文化设置 安装完Jenkins后,发现却是英文的,对于有英语困难的小伙伴用起来着实不太方便,于是考虑进行中文化。 Jenkins中文化设置是比较简单的,只需安装插件Locale,并进行简单的配置就可以轻松搞定了。 1. 后续会单独介绍插件这块内容!) 1)打开Jenkins官网的插件页面https://plugins.jenkins.io/: ? 2)在搜索框输入“Locale”,来查找插件Locale: ? 4)登录Jenkins,在【Manage Jenkins】-> 【Manage Plugins】-> 【高级】,选择上传刚刚下载的插件Locale,完成插件的安装,安装后重启。 ? 2. 中文化设置 进入【Manage Jenkins】-> 【Configure System】 - >【Default Language】,设置为zh_CN,【应用】、【保存】即可。 ?
css"> table { border:0;border-collapse:collapse;} td { font:normal 12px/17px Arial;padding:2px /scripts/jquery.js" type="text/javascript"></script> <script type="text/javascript"> //插件编写 ;(function } }); })(jQuery); //插件应用 $(function(){ $("#table2") .alterBgColor() //应用插件
改版的原因: 图片 相当蛋疼 下面是 基于现有插件 需要做的一些改变的清单 1.background 替换成service worker: 需要注意的是:不使用时终止,需要时重新启动(类似于事件页面 (service worker独立于页面,无法使用window对象) 2.v3 废弃了一些方法: chrome.extension.sendRequest() chrome.extension.onRequest content_security_policy": { "extension_pages": "script-src 'self' 'unsafe-eval'; object-src 'self'", } 添加unsafe-eval标实,但是插件会给我们抛错 后续有进展再更新 好了 找到官方解释了,不支持了 完犊子了 图片 4.尝试解决方法 通过webpack构建 参考文档:https://www.it1352.com/2289545.html https://github.com /StarkShang/vite-plugin-chrome-extension https://github.com/ALiangLiang/vue-webpack-chrome-extension-template
2019 年第 31 篇,总 55 篇文章 上一篇文章 推荐了 3 个 Github 相关的项目,这次继续推荐 3 个项目,严格说是 3 个插件,主要是帮助搜索 Github 项目和在线阅读代码的插件。 2. octohint 第二个插件可以帮助阅读代码时候,搜索定位同个变量出现的位置,项目地址如下: https://github.com/pd4d10/octohint 下面是使用的一个 demo 展示 id=com.pd4d10.octohint-2FFP8Y4P2A 火狐:参考 https://github.com/pd4d10/octohint/issues/24#issuecomment-450467200 OctoLinker OctoLinker 也是一个浏览器的插件,其作用主要是可以跳转到导入的库代码中,项目地址如下: https://github.com/OctoLinker/OctoLinker 另外包括上次介绍的三个 Github 工具,加上本文推荐的三个插件项目地址的获取方式如下: 关注公众号“机器学习与计算机视觉” 在微信公众号后台留言 『github』 欢迎关注我的微信公众号--机器学习与计算机视觉
常规的办法通常是需要访问google应用商店来安装这个插件,但这在国内基本行不通。 这里介绍的是一种离线安装办法,百分百管用。 或者直接浏览器中输入地址:chrome://extensions/自动进入插件安装页面。 如何使用? 进入GitHub,找一个项目,点开一个文件,在工具栏里会看到多了一个View File的按钮,点击此按钮,如下图所示,红圈的按钮是安装完插件后多出来的按钮。打开速度非常的快。 另外推荐一具是github1s.com,非常好用,而且是vscode的风格。 使用方法是把github.com换成github1s.com即可。什么插件也不需要安装,更简单。 换成github1s.com/yangyongzhen/Easy8583Ans,在浏览器中访问。
本文作者:IMWeb 苍都 原文出处:IMWeb社区 未经同意,禁止转载 vue2 构建的大型单页面项目
GitHub上传本地项目 之 Github设置SSH keys (1) 步骤 1、在MAC上新建一个文件夹 2、在 GitHub 上新建一个仓库 Paste_Image.png Paste_Image.png 3、cd + 把刚才在 MAC 上新建的文件夹拖进终端 Paste_Image.png 4、git clone + GitHub -m "描述" (“ ” 引号里面输入你的描述 随意) Paste_Image.png 10、git push origin master (最后push到GitHub
上一节我们通过一个很简单并且很有意义的插件 WP-Sofa 给大家讲解了如何自己动手开始写插件,今天将和大家讲解如和窗体化这个插件,并推出我们的沙发二代。 看文章:窗体化侧边栏 废话说完了,那我们开始我们今天的主题:窗体化你的插件。 首先,我们让插件能够支持 Widget 只是一个额外的功能,原有的手工调用的功能还是要保持。 下面我们开始 widget 这个插件: 首先了解下基本的 Widget 语法: <? 然后又从 WordPress Widgets 说明文档上知道:不要在插件导入之后执行任何代码,并使用 plugins_loaded 这个hook。 根据上面的分析,我们的 Sofa 的 widget 函数为: 窗体化插件 2。
GitHub地址: https://github.com/PanJiaChen/vue-element-admin 项目在线预览:https://panjiachen.gitee.io/vue-element-admin GitHub地址:GitHub - PanJiaChen/vue-admin-template: a vue2.0 minimal admin template 根据用户角色来动态生成侧边栏的分支:GitHub - PanJiaChen/vue-admin-template at permission-control 2、安装和运行 # 解压压缩包vue-admin-template-permission-control.zip run dev 三、前端配置 1、禁用ESLint语法检查 vue.config.js 第30行处禁用ESLint语法检查 这个玩意怕出现一些前端的细节的玩意 lintOnSave: false, 2、 htmlWhitespaceSensitivity": "ignore" } 3、修改页面标题 src/settings.js 第3行处修改页面标题 4、国际化设置 src/main.js 第7行处修改语言 针对插件的中文化
别以为TJ君说的是天方夜谭,就在前不久的 GitHub Universe 2021开发者大会上,GitHub官方正式宣布了一款名为 Copilot工具的更新。 说起Copilot这个名字,相信一直关注GitHub的小伙伴马上脑海中会浮现出今年早些时候看到的新闻。 就在今年夏天,GitHub 官方和OpenAI联合发布了一款AI自动编程工具,其名字正是 GitHub Copilot 。 安装重启之后就可以在工具栏看到安装好的Copilot 然后登陆GitHub账号,同意相关条款 那说了那么久,这款号称可以自动编码的插件具体使用效果如何呢? 不过到底怎么样,还是要用一用才知道,所以小伙伴们赶紧来获取仓库地址和插件下载方法,赶紧试试吧,地址如下: 点击下方卡片,关注公众号“TJ君” 回复“copilot”,获取仓库地址 关注我,每天了解一个牛